Dance clubs are great places for meeting people. Where else can you walk up to a complete stranger that you find attractive and ask them to spend 5 minutes with you without feeling like a complete idiot? The great thing about dance clubs is the relatively large number of people you can meet in a relatively short time. Dance clubs are perfect places for improving your meeting people skills. You can flirt, exchange eye contact, practice ice breaking techniques and rapidly improve your confidence. But the conversation is usually superficial and people may find it uncomfortable if you try to get too deep and personal in this very informal environment. The challenge with meeting people at a dance club is that you can see what they are from the outside, but it is very difficult to see what they are from the inside. It is extremely difficult to talk at a dance club above the loud music or to have anything more than a superficial conversation. Another challenge may be that many dance clubs are dominated by a particular age range. If you are above 40, you may feel out of place at a dance club which is popular with people 21-25. But if you ask around you should be able to find dance clubs nearby that are popular with people of all ages.Salsa Clubs are much better places to meet people than a regular dance club. Salsa is a rapidly growing trend which is popular among
people of all ages and cultures. If you go to a Salsa club you will see all types of people there, it is not just for the young and elegant. In contrast to a regular dance club, in a Salsa Club a 70 year old will not feel out of place. And if they dance well a 70-year-old will be treated with respect and may be one of the most popular dancers in the club. Salsa is popular in many countries around the world. If you travel, you can find Salsa clubs almost wherever you go. Learning Salsa will open many doors to meeting people.
Almost everyone who learns Salsa takes Salsa lessons in a dance school. Dance schools are great places to meet people. Usually you will change partners frequently; since instructors prefer that you learn how to dance with different people. You are out having fun with strangers who share an interest that you do. Your fellow Salsa students are extremely easy to meet.
Unlike most types of dances you can learn in a school, with Salsa you can meet people outside of the school as well. There are Salsa clubs everywhere. Just look in the internet for Salsa in your area and you will probably find a Salsa club not far away. Tango and Flamingo, for example, are also very cool dances. But once you have learned how to do them, where can you go to dance? They may be fun to learn, but they will not help you to meet people as much as Salsa.
Once you have learned some basic steps, you can go out to a Salsa club, perhaps with other students from the school and practice what you have learned. Salsa is a couple’s dance. At a Salsa Club, people expect you to come up to them and ask them to dance. Since you are dancing closely, you will find it easier to exchange light conversation with your partner than in a regular dance club.
How difficult is it to learn Salsa? Almost anyone can do it. There are three major types of dances played in Salsa clubs, each with
various levels of difficulty. Meringue, Salsa, Bachata. Meringue is extremely easy and can be learned by most people, in one or two lessons.
After two lessons, you will not be the hottest Meringue dancer in the club, but you will know the basics enough to ask someone to dance Meringue with you. Salsa is more complicated. Women can learn the basic steps in 5-10 lessons. Men, since they have to lead, will find it more challenging and may need 10-20 lessons to feel confident. Bachata has a simple basic step that can be learned in a few minutes. To be a great Bachata dancer may take many hours of practice. But since few dance schools spend a lot of time teaching Bachata, few people are very good at it. Knowing the basic steps is enough to ask someone to dance.
